The company:
Based in South Essex, you will be joining a well-known manufacturing company which specialises in the design, manufacturing, build and installation of automated machinery working in several industries. Due to large expansion, the company is now looking for an experienced mechanical technician to join and be part of their manufacturing team. Offering a range of benefits including flexi-start time, private healthcare, generous holiday allowance and more, this is an excellent time to join this fast-expanding company.
Essential duties and responsibilities:
- Work as part of a team involved with the build of large machinery and smaller assemblies
- Work to specific engineering drawings & specifications
- Use of a wide range of equipment and tools, including machinery
- Conducting trials and tests on machinery
- Piping, testing and fault-finding pneumatic logic circuits
- Assembly, commissioning, support and service work at customers' sites
